At the start of the day I have difficulty on turning on my PC I have to turn on my UPS then wait 20-40min after that it turns on normally. I tried going to the pc store where I bought the pc but when they try to start my pc it starts normally. I tried different outlets in our house and directly connecting the PSU cable to the outlet also I tried using my neighbors outlet still no luck.

I've tried the paper clip test and the PSU is working fine and used a multimeter to test all the output voltage of the 24 pins. The output voltage is all correct
This is the images that I based my testing
https://www.google.com/url?sa=i&url=https://www.quora.com/What-are-the-standard-output-voltages-of-a-computer-s-power-supply-How-Why&psig=AOvVaw1cBdU58rrKM4VwfvHUO-f9&ust=1674562851619000&source=images&cd=vfe&ved=0CA0QjRxqFwoTCLD_2vHW3fwCFQAAAAAdAAAAABAD

Also the 6pins are fine with the output if 12V

And I replaced the CMOS battery with a new one

But when I connect it to my motherboard it wont start unless I wait for 20-40min then comeback to turn it on

When my pc turns on there's no other problem I use it 8-11hours per day for work
The only change in the BIOS settings is that I enabled my XMP profile for my RAM

SPECS
MOBO: Gigabyte B550M DS3H AC
CPU: RYZEN 5 5600G
RAM: RIPJAWS GSKILL 2X8GB 3200MHZ
GPU: ASUS GEFORCE GTX 1050TI 4GB
POWER SUPPLY: SILVERSTONE 500W STRIDER ESSENTIAL (SST-ST50F-ES230)
BOOT DRIVE: 128GB WALRAM 2.5 SSD
HARD DRIVES: 500GB ST3500413AS
1TB TOSHIBA MK1002TSKB
4 INTAKE FANS
1 EXAUST FAN
